The Wild West is often romanticised in cinema, but beneath the tales of gunslingers and gold rushes lie stories of those on the fringes of society. This curated list of ten western films focuses on the lives of prostitutes, offering a different lens through which to view this iconic genre. These films not only provide a gritty look at the era but also delve into themes of survival, redemption, and the human spirit, making them invaluable for anyone interested in a deeper understanding of the American frontier.

The Ballad of Cable Hogue (1970)

Description: This film follows Cable Hogue, a man left for dead in the desert, who finds water and builds a stagecoach stop, employing a prostitute named Hildy. It's a unique blend of comedy and drama, showcasing the life of a prostitute in the West.

Fact: Sam Peckinpah, known for his violent westerns, directed this film, which is one of his more light-hearted works. The film's ending was changed from the original script due to studio pressure.

Bad Girls (1994)

Description: Four prostitutes escape from a brothel and embark on a journey to start anew, encountering various challenges along the way. This film offers a feminist take on the western genre.

Fact: The film was initially conceived as a more serious drama but was turned into an action-adventure due to studio demands. It was one of the first westerns to feature an all-female lead cast.
